ah right ok, I'll wait for a second oppinion too, I just dont understand that I've been running BF2 all day with no errors and for prime 95 to error within half a second :confused: :confused:
 
A lot of ppl find that with games, where it will work fine with no probs at all mainly because the CPU/RAM isnt being fully loaded all the time so no errors will occur, but as Prime95 has it running at 100% load for an extended period of time, thats when errors can occur.

This can be because the CPU cant handle the clock speed or hasnt got enough power to let it run at the higher clock speed.
 
I would have thought so yeah, increase it in small increments if your BIOS allows you to, till you can run Prime95 stable.

For max stability you should run it for a good few hours, but at the moment to see if the increased voltage is helping then 10-20mins should give an ok indication.
